What training will the apprentice take and what qualification will the apprentice get at the end?
Early years Educator Level 3 Apprenticeship Standard:
- You will be working towards an Advanced Diploma Early Years
- Your apprenticeship will last for 13 months, where you will be supported by a dedicated assessor throughout your apprenticeship, as well as a mentor and other staff within the nursery
- This apprenticeship requires dedication, commitment & punctuality for you to be successful
- This apprenticeship will open doors to a variety of future roles & career paths within the childcare sector
- Training will take place in the workplace
- You will need to attend online training with your assessor for 10 days out of your 13-month apprenticeship, for your classroom-based learning and you will be working within the nursery for the rest of the time with the support of your dedicated childcare assessor
- You will complete a qualification in paediatric first aid
